Output d68a80cc6d87365c4552c51318996db257ff947834026474c22ed648ee7b2f1c:0

value
355088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ab75a59eddadb7426d0aa27833767cef7890326 OP_EQUAL
address
3Cst1XpwSh3tyxAKzzXagXHvoNpZogj9Cm
transaction
d68a80cc6d87365c4552c51318996db257ff947834026474c22ed648ee7b2f1c
confirmations
232564
spent
true